{"query": "Easton: Bosom", "count": 13, "results": [{"id": "card_n_91994699501a", "title": "Easton: Bosom", "shelf": "dictionary", "surface": "secular", "snippet": "In the East objects are carried in the bosom which Europeans carry in the pocket. To have in one’s bosom indicates kindness, secrecy, or intimacy (Gen. 16:5; 2 Sam. 12:8). This custom, along with the use of raised tables like ours, was introduced among the Jews after the Captivity."}, {"id": "card_n_e1df4c77bac5", "title": "Easton: Word, The", "shelf": "dictionary", "surface": "secular", "snippet": "(Gr.
